For People Graduating or Leaving the University Staff

When you are no longer a student at Tokyo Tech due to graduation or completion of your degree, when you are no longer a member of the Tokyo Tech staff due to a transfer or leaving your job, or if a PC will no longer be the property of Tokyo Tech, all software installed under the Tokyo Tech umbrella license must be uninstalled.

Individually-owned computer
All software installed under the Tokyo Tech umbrella license must be uninstalled by referring to the Uninstallation Procedure.

University-owned computer

  • When moving the computer to another university due to a job transfer or other reason
  • , all software installed under the Tokyo Tech umbrella license must be uninstalled by referring to the Uninstallation Procedure.
  • When disposing of the computer
  • , unless it is not possible to uninstall the software (due to a computer breakdown, for instance), all software installed under the Tokyo Tech umbrella license must be uninstalled by referring to the Uninstallation Procedure.

Scope of responsibility
The individual bears full responsibility if the terms of the license are violated.

Uninstallation Procedure

To uninstall, first, try using the standard uninstallation procedure. In Windows, uninstall from "Add or Remove Programs" (XP) or "Uninstall a Program" (Vista) in the Control Panel.
